[Sendai Children's Foundation] Paternity leave as a key to 'recruitment power': Free consultation and hands-on support for SMEs launched
The Sendai Children's Foundation has launched the 'Paternity Leave Support Program' for small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) in Sendai. Through free expert consultation and hands-on guidance, the program assists companies in promoting paternity leave, establishing systems, and improving workplace environments to strengthen their recruitment competitiveness.

This program provides free consultation services and follow-up support to SMEs in Sendai to help promote paternity leave and manage the balance between work and childcare.
Experts such as Labor and Social Security Attorneys and Small and Medium Enterprise Management Consultants provide careful support according to each company's situation, ranging from casual advice to system establishment and internal implementation.
'Paternity leave' is the #1 piece of corporate information regarding marriage and childbirth that makes young people want to work for a company!
As the paternity leave adoption rate hits a record high, 'paternity leave' has become more than just a benefit; it is a critical factor for young people when choosing an employer.
According to an awareness survey by the Ministry of Health, Labour and Welfare, 'paternity leave' was the top-rated corporate information regarding marriage and childbirth that attracts young job seekers.
Promoting paternity leave within a company is an important management issue directly linked to talent retention, acquisition, and stronger recruitment power.

[Start with a casual consultation] Consultation counter (2-step consultation)
Experts (Labor and Social Security Attorneys, Small and Medium Enterprise Management Consultants) will provide free consultations on paternity leave adoption and work-life balance.
Examples of consultation:
- Procedures for paternity leave (Social insurance/benefits applications, etc.)
- Checking available subsidies
- Reviewing internal regulations and compliance with legal amendments (paternity leave, childcare leave, etc.)
- Organizing internal coordination and workflow during leave
- Organizing tasks to create a comfortable workplace
Consultation method: In-person, office visit, online, telephone, or email.
[For companies wanting to do more] Follow-up support (Hands-on support)
For companies aiming for more concrete institutional development and workplace improvement, experts provide 'follow-up support.' They carefully interview each company and provide support from system creation to operation and retention.
Examples of support:
- Creating internal handbooks tailored to each company
- Proposals for available subsidies and application support
- Creating handover schedules and checklists
- Supporting the introduction of childcare-related systems
- Individual explanations for staff and managers
- Conducting employee training and information sessions

Outline:
Target: SMEs in Sendai (up to 2,000 employees)
Cost: Free
Application: Via a dedicated web form
